Opinions on who has the most powerful canary cry/sonic scream across all of the shows? There was Laurel (sonic device), Evelyn (Laurel's sonic device with a higher frequency), Silver Banshee, Black Siren, and Dinah Drake.

In my own opinion, I believe Silver Banshee's is the most powerful, but Black Siren's is the best sounding imo.